Do you have any question about this error?
Message type: E = Error
Message class: MC - Aggregate: views, matchcodes, lock objects
Message number: 862
Message text: You cannot insert in front of an inherited condition.
The conditions transferred from the generalization should be placed
together at the start of the list for clarity.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Insert new conditions following those marked as inherited.
Error message extract from SAP system. Copyright SAP SE.
MC862
- You cannot insert in front of an inherited condition. ?The SAP error message MC862, which states "You cannot insert in front of an inherited condition," typically occurs in the context of condition records in pricing or condition maintenance within the SAP system. This error arises when you attempt to insert a new condition record that conflicts with existing inherited conditions.
Cause:
- Inherited Conditions: In SAP, conditions can be inherited from higher-level records (like pricing conditions from a higher hierarchy). If you try to insert a new condition that is supposed to be at a lower level but conflicts with an inherited condition, the system will throw this error.
- Condition Type Configuration: The configuration of the condition type may not allow for the insertion of new records in certain scenarios, especially if the condition is already defined at a higher level.
- Sequence of Conditions: The order of conditions is important in SAP. If you are trying to insert a condition in a sequence that is not allowed due to existing conditions, this error will occur.
Solution:
- Check Existing Conditions: Review the existing condition records to understand the hierarchy and see if the condition you are trying to insert is conflicting with any inherited conditions.
- Adjust Condition Records: If necessary, modify or delete the conflicting inherited condition before attempting to insert the new condition.
- Use the Correct Transaction: Ensure you are using the correct transaction for maintaining condition records (e.g., VK11, VK12, VK13 for pricing conditions).
- Consult Configuration: If you have access, check the configuration of the condition type in the SAP customizing settings (transaction SPRO) to see if there are restrictions on inserting conditions.
- Seek Help from SAP Support: If the issue persists and you cannot resolve it, consider reaching out to your SAP support team or consulting SAP documentation for further assistance.
Related Information:
By following these steps, you should be able to identify the cause of the error and implement a solution to resolve it.
Get instant SAP help. Start your 7-day free trial now.
MC861
Inherited condition cannot be deleted.
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
MC860
Inherited table & cannot be deleted.
What causes this issue? The table was transferred from the generalization and therefore can only be deleted if it is also deleted from the view to th...
MC863
You cannot paste in front of an inherited condition.
INCLUDE 'MC862' OBJECT DOKU ID NAError message extract from SAP system. Copyright SAP SE. ...
MC864
You cannot select an inherited condition.
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.